Body
Education
Adam Joseph Rothman was educated at University of Michigan[3]. Doctoral advisors include Elizaveta Levina[4], a mathematical statistician[15], b. 1974[16], of Soviet Union[17], awarded the Fellow of the Institute of Mathematical Statistics[18] and Ji Zhu[5], a statistician[19], of People's Republic of China[20], awarded the Fellow of the American Statistical Association[21].
Career and Affiliations
Adam Joseph Rothman worked as a researcher[2]. Doctoral students include Bradley Price[8], a statistician[22] and Aaron J. Molstad[9].
